As a life coach, I specialize in helping adults at midlife, which can be a time of celebration, confusion or both. If you are in that phase of life and are longing for a more fulfilling experience, where you're actively working toward reaching your cherished goals and dreams, you might be a perfect candidate for life coaching.

I work with clients on such common midlife issues as:
  • Clarifying how you want to live the rest of your life and identifying your priorities.
  • Creating more satisfying work-life balance.
  • Actively addressing the health and self-image issues that can become more prevalent as you age.
  • Assessing whether you want to stay on your current career path or helping you successfully transition to the new career you've chosen.
Relationships often become quite challenging at midlife, so I can help you grapple with such things as:
  • Managing the "sandwich generation" complexities of caring for both your children and your aging parents.
  • Dealing with the empty nest syndrome after your children have established their own lives and, if you have a partner, redefining your relationship as a couple without children at home.
  • Navigating the often-difficult waters of midlife dating if you are single.
During our coaching sessions, we will collaborate to:
  • Assess your life, identifying the areas that are working well for you and those that need some attention.
  • Generate and prioritize goals that would contribute significantly to your quality of life.
  • Draw upon your inner wisdom and creativity.
  • Brainstorm ideas in order to create specific plans for achieving your goals.
  • Stay motivated and on track. Each week, you will agree to accomplish certain steps in your action plan prior to our next coaching session. This accountability will help keep you focused, rather than getting so distracted by the busy-ness of daily life that your larger goals get lost in the shuffle.
Unlike therapy, life coaching doesn’t involve addressing your emotional issues or looking into your past. Instead, it revolves around formulating goals and generating accomplishments in the here-and-now with the help of a trained professional to help you along the way.
